A "32 ECT" box is really a corrugated cardboard box that has been tested and located to acquire an "edge crush test" strength of 32 lbs . for every inch of edge. This means the box can withstand nearly 32 kilos of weight on Every inch of its edges without remaining pulverized or collapsing.
A more moderen standard which has achieved widespread acceptance is the sting Crush Test. The Edge Crush Test, or ECT, is a real overall performance test specifically linked to a box's stacking energy. ECT is usually a measure with the edgewise compressive power of a corrugated board.
The Mullen Test measures the bursting energy of corrugated boxes. Put simply, it tests the amount of stress or force needed to rupture the wall in the box. Boxes that pass this standard are rated with the appropriate # or lb designation – two hundred#, 275#, and so on.
32 ECT boxes can be a lightweight and cost-efficient packaging selection that happen to be rated utilizing the Edge Crush Test (ECT). The ECT measures the stacking toughness of a box, that's its capacity to resist crushing from exterior force.
